MEMO — Finance Team

Hi all, quick heads-up on the Q3 cash-flow forecast for Brindlewood Supply. Inflows look steady thanks to the Harrowgate contract renewals, but outflows spike in August with the warehouse refit. Net position stays positive, barely. Marta will circulate the full model Friday. One item to flag for leadership follows below.

board note of tadup-tajog: Headcount on the Oliiel team goes from 31 to 88 by the end of February. Gross margin on Oliiel came in at 62 percent against a plan of 29 percent.

Finance Review Summary — Kestrun Foods

For branch managers: the expansion into the Averlin coastal region is funded and on schedule. Capital outlay is tracking 4% under budget, with two depots leased and a third in negotiation. Staffing plans transfer to regional HR next month. Strategic detail for the expansion appears in the confidential note below.

internal memo for yahof-bajop: Tamethox Group is in early talks to buy Ulamirek Group for about $64.0 million. The Aldiel launch date is October 11, and nothing goes to the press before then.

Subject: New key for the Stonepress rebuild service

Hi all — welcome aboard! We rotated the credential for Stonepress, the service that handles incremental static site rebuilds, this morning. Old keys stop working Friday, so update your local config before then. Rebuilds should feel noticeably faster too. The new key is right below.

API key for yahig-tadup: kto7_ubizbYm

Hi Marenna,

Welcome to the on-call rotation for the Quillbrook UI team. Snapshot tests for our component library run on every merge to trunk; failures usually mean an intentional visual change that needs a baseline update, not a bug. Triage steps, approval flow, and known flaky suites are documented on the internal page below.

runbook for taduf-kawef: https://confluence.qorvelsys.internal/projects/display/display/pages